Coding Standards

Bien sûr des bisous ! :heart:

On est bien d’accord, c’est d’ailleurs pour ça que je n’ai pas parlé de généralisation aux plugins tout de suite, bien que le système (enfin … l’extension phpcs quoi) est prévu pour : créer/modifier le .gitignore, créer ou modifier composer.json, ce qui peut presque être automatisé. Créer le fichier phpcs.xml.dist et adapter le contenu au plugin, c’est plus compliqué.

À titre d’exemple, mise en place des outils de développement pour un plugin, passe d’autofix et baseline pour phpstan.

On peut appliquer à tous les plugins-dist si ça vous branche.

Gogogo :slight_smile:

1 « J'aime »

Bah du coup, j’ai reporté pour les plugins-dist sur la 4.0 aussi (textwheel avait déjà été reporté d’ailleurs).

La question de pose des plugins breves, dev, petitions, squelettes-par-rubriques, voire organiseur : qui n’ont pas reçu dans master (ni 4.0 donc) les dev-tools…
Je pense qu’on peut oublier pour sûr : grenier, vertebres, jquery-ui

1 « J'aime »

Amha on peut les laisser de côté puisqu’ils ne sont plus distribués dans la distrib « officielle ».

1 « J'aime »